.DateRangePicker_wrapper__Cn2jU{display:flex;align-items:center}.DateRangePicker_fieldContainer__8iUQM{display:flex;align-items:center;gap:12px}.DateRangePicker_label__XPwNH{font-size:12px;color:#6b7280;font-weight:700;text-transform:uppercase;letter-spacing:.05em;margin-bottom:4px}.DateRangePicker_iconWrapper__YKOkv{height:100%}.DateRangePicker_input___CQr0{border:0;background-color:transparent;box-shadow:none;height:auto;padding:0;text-align:left;font-size:17px;font-weight:700;color:#111827}.DateRangePicker_input___CQr0:focus-visible{outline:none;box-shadow:none}.DateRangePicker_iconButton__gFT7X{display:none}.DateRangePicker_icon___SsbQ{width:1rem;height:1rem;color:#6b7280;transition:transform .2s ease}.DateRangePicker_iconOpen__XgJKq{transform:rotate(180deg)}.DateRangePicker_divider__SZ5HD{height:46px;width:1px;background-color:#d1d5db;margin-left:20px;margin-right:20px}.DateRangePicker_mobileDivider__LlHeE{display:none;width:1px;background-color:#e5e7eb;margin:0 16px;align-self:stretch}.DateRangePicker_popoverContent__h4b8Q{width:auto;overflow:hidden;padding:0;background-color:#fff;border-radius:12px;box-shadow:0 10px 15px -3px rgba(0,0,0,.1),0 4px 6px -2px rgba(0,0,0,.05)}.DateRangePicker_dateContainer__FkoL8{display:flex;flex-direction:column;align-items:flex-start;width:100%}@media(max-width:768px){.DateRangePicker_wrapper__Cn2jU{width:100%;justify-content:flex-start}.DateRangePicker_fieldContainer__8iUQM{flex:1;min-width:0;max-width:calc(50% - 16px)}.DateRangePicker_dateContainer__FkoL8{width:100%;align-items:flex-start}.DateRangePicker_input___CQr0{text-align:left}.DateRangePicker_divider__SZ5HD{display:none}.DateRangePicker_mobileDivider__LlHeE{display:block;flex-shrink:0}}.GuestSelector_trigger__LNM7R{height:auto;min-height:24px;width:100%;border-radius:6px;background-color:transparent;font-size:17px;font-weight:700;color:#111827;outline:none;text-align:left;line-height:100%;display:flex;align-items:center;justify-content:flex-start}.GuestSelector_trigger__LNM7R:focus{border-color:hsl(var(--ring));box-shadow:0 0 0 3px hsl(var(--ring)/.5)}.GuestSelector_content__M8cjp{width:380px;padding:16px;background-color:#fff!important;border-radius:16px;box-shadow:0 10px 15px -3px rgba(0,0,0,.1),0 4px 6px -2px rgba(0,0,0,.05)}.GuestSelector_container__rhmkS{gap:12px}.GuestSelector_container__rhmkS,.GuestSelector_section__dbXCo{display:flex;flex-direction:column}.GuestSelector_sectionTitle__352hj{font-size:.875rem;font-weight:600;margin-bottom:8px}.GuestSelector_buttonGroup___6mPR{display:flex;gap:8px;flex-wrap:wrap}.GuestSelector_numberButton__OaMog{width:48px;height:48px;border-radius:10px;font-size:1rem;font-weight:500;transition:all .2s}.GuestSelector_numberButton__OaMog.GuestSelector_inactive__wRABL{background-color:#f3f4f6;color:#374151}.GuestSelector_numberButton__OaMog.GuestSelector_inactive__wRABL:hover{background-color:#e5e7eb}.GuestSelector_numberButton__OaMog.GuestSelector_active__RxmA1{color:#fff}.GuestSelector_ageLabel__UWyRH{font-size:.875rem;color:#6b7280;margin-bottom:8px;display:block}.GuestSelector_ageSelect__0kNhD{height:44px;border-radius:8px;border:1px solid hsl(var(--border));background-color:hsl(var(--background));padding-inline:10px;padding-block:6px;font-size:.95rem;box-shadow:0 1px 2px 0 rgba(0,0,0,.05);outline:none}.GuestSelector_ageSelect__0kNhD:focus{border-color:hsl(var(--ring));box-shadow:0 0 0 3px hsl(var(--ring)/.5)}.GuestSelector_saveButton__d6G0W{width:100%;font-size:.875rem;padding-block:8px;height:40px;border-radius:8px;transition:opacity .2s;color:#fff}.GuestSelector_saveButton__d6G0W:hover{opacity:.9}.GuestSelector_iconOpen__5Lc9_,.GuestSelector_icon__yvL7o{display:none}